#6 Minnesota State Defeats Upper Iowa 83-54 at Home Extending Winning Streak to Seven

Mankato, Minn. --- #6 Minnesota State collected its seven consecutive win and third NSIC win on the season with an 83-54 home win against Upper Iowa.

With the win, MSU improves to 7-0 (3-0 NSIC), while UIU drops to 4-4 (0-3 NSIC) on the season. 
   
The Mavericks never trailed in the game and stepped the gas pedal early on as they led the Peacocks by 13 points and closed the first quarter 22-9. 
 
Eight different Mavericks scored in the first half and freshman Natalie Bremer's 13 points in the first half helped the Mavericks to a 44-27 lead, while sophomore Destinee Bursch netted nine points.

 
The Mavericks outscored the Peacocks 24-13 in the third quarter shooting .400 in three-pointers. In the last quarter MSU would attain the largest lead of the game by 33 points, before closing the game with an 83-54 win. 
  
Bursch, who shot at .500 from the field, led the Mavericks with 23 points and five rebounds. Bremer netted 19 points and added six rebounds also.  Junior Joey Batt scored 13 points and hauled in six rebounds as well. 
    
As a unit, Minnesota State shot 40.7% from the field and scored 34 points off turnovers. They also passed out 14 assists and recorded 51 rebounds and 17 steals.   
   
Minnesota State continues its season at home this Friday hosting Augustana at Taylor Center. Tip-off is scheduled for 5:00 p.m.
